Prelude photography editorial shot by Silvia Amicarelli.

Prelude

Prelude photography editorial is the sequel of “About Body Memory” but also the hint of its continuation. It’s a photographic project about the body movement and the shapes it takes. This time isn’t the eclectic styling that follows the movements but the lights and shadows that draw the contours. The place is also important: in the historic center close to the sea, where the eternity of time has fixed the stones of city in perpetual immobility and where the sea dances in the horizontal plane of the earth’s surface. There Michele dances, raises movement to the sky and shapes the sunlight into appearances that our soul and mind devour.The result is a concentrate of expressiveness and energy.

Bio of the photographer: Silvia Amicarelli

Born in Trani on April 1, 1991, she immediately showed her passion for visual art with her love for drawing and the intention to dedicate herself to it in the future. Over the years she had to give up this purpose to follow the desires of a more economically stable future by dedicating herself to technical studies that she never loved.
After obtaining her diploma, a little with difficulty following a car accident that led her to have health problems, she decided to get closer to the world of visual art first with oil painting and then with photography. Photography, which had accompanied her since childhood thanks to her father and his passion. Over the years she has become a professional photographer thanks to numerous commercial works (fashion and food sector) without neglecting to carry on her personal and editorial projects. In 2020 she created the creative agency Shake Studio dedicating herself to the production of content for the commercial and editorial sector and in 2023 she joined the English artists’ collective Thursday’s Child Global.
